Are You There, Sloane? is moody, atmospheric and dark (mostly). There's witchcraft, Tarot, séances, nightmares, strange noises in the walls, midnight walks through misty woods... You name it, if it's gothic, it's there. Ok, there's no abandoned castles or abbeys... but you get the idea.
The gothic is my favorite genre. It's my happy place. I love ghosts and the full moon. I read Tarot cards and I would absolutely spend the night in a haunted house.
But Sloane isn't just gothic in the sense of setting and vibes. The reader is forced to look at the very gothic nature of being human. Of being haunted by your past; your regrets. You find yourself asking "What would I do in that situation?" And maybe you can't answer.
We're all haunted. We all have ghosts.
